Table Location

ID 14
Namespace: Microsoft.Inventory.Location

Properties

Name Value
Caption Location
DataCaptionFields 1,2
DrillDownPageID Microsoft.Inventory.Location."Location List"
LookupPageID Microsoft.Inventory.Location."Location List"
DataClassification CustomerContent

Fields

Name Type Description
Code Code[10]
Name Text[100]
"Default Bin Code" Code[20]
"Name 2" Text[50]
Address Text[100]
"Address 2" Text[50]
City Text[30]
"Phone No." Text[30]
"Phone No. 2" Text[30]
"Telex No." Text[30]
"Fax No." Text[30]
Contact Text[100]
"Post Code" Code[20]
County Text[30]
"E-Mail" Text[80]
"Home Page" Text[90]
"Country/Region Code" Code[10]
"Use As In-Transit" Boolean
"Require Put-away" Boolean
"Require Pick" Boolean
"Cross-Dock Due Date Calc." DateFormula
"Use Cross-Docking" Boolean
"Require Receive" Boolean
"Require Shipment" Boolean
"Bin Mandatory" Boolean
"Directed Put-away and Pick" Boolean
"Default Bin Selection" Microsoft.Warehouse.Structure."Location Default Bin Selection"
"Outbound Whse. Handling Time" DateFormula
"Inbound Whse. Handling Time" DateFormula
"Put-away Template Code" Code[10]
"Use Put-away Worksheet" Boolean
"Pick According to FEFO" Boolean
"Allow Breakbulk" Boolean
"Bin Capacity Policy" Option
"Pick Bin Policy" Microsoft.Warehouse.Activity."Pick Bin Policy"
"Check Whse. Class" Boolean
"Put-away Bin Policy" Microsoft.Warehouse.Activity."Put-away Bin Policy"
"Open Shop Floor Bin Code" Code[20]
"To-Production Bin Code" Code[20]
"From-Production Bin Code" Code[20]
"Prod. Consump. Whse. Handling" Microsoft.Manufacturing.Setup."Prod. Consump. Whse. Handling"
"Adjustment Bin Code" Code[20]
"Prod. Output Whse. Handling" Microsoft.Manufacturing.Setup."Prod. Output Whse. Handling"
"Always Create Put-away Line" Boolean
"Always Create Pick Line" Boolean
"Special Equipment" Option
"Receipt Bin Code" Code[20]
"Shipment Bin Code" Code[20]
"Cross-Dock Bin Code" Code[20]
"To-Assembly Bin Code" Code[20]
"From-Assembly Bin Code" Code[20]
"Asm.-to-Order Shpt. Bin Code" Code[20]
"To-Job Bin Code" Code[20]
"Asm. Consump. Whse. Handling" Microsoft.Assembly.Document."Asm. Consump. Whse. Handling"
"Job Consump. Whse. Handling" Microsoft.Projects.Project.Setup."Job Consump. Whse. Handling"
"Base Calendar Code" Code[10]
"Use ADCS" Boolean
SystemId Guid
SystemCreatedAt DateTime
SystemCreatedBy Guid
SystemModifiedAt DateTime
SystemModifiedBy Guid
SystemRowVersion BigInteger

Methods

RequireShipment

procedure RequireShipment(LocationCode: Code[10]): Boolean

Parameters

Name Type Description
LocationCode Code[10]

Returns

Type Description
Boolean

RequirePicking

procedure RequirePicking(LocationCode: Code[10]): Boolean

Parameters

Name Type Description
LocationCode Code[10]

Returns

Type Description
Boolean

RequireReceive

procedure RequireReceive(LocationCode: Code[10]): Boolean

Parameters

Name Type Description
LocationCode Code[10]

Returns

Type Description
Boolean

RequirePutaway

procedure RequirePutaway(LocationCode: Code[10]): Boolean

Parameters

Name Type Description
LocationCode Code[10]

Returns

Type Description
Boolean

BinMandatory

procedure BinMandatory(LocationCode: Code[10]): Boolean

Parameters

Name Type Description
LocationCode Code[10]

Returns

Type Description
Boolean

GetLocationSetup

procedure GetLocationSetup(LocationCode: Code[10], var Location2: Record Location): Boolean

Parameters

Name Type Description
LocationCode Code[10]
Location2 Record Location

Returns

Type Description
Boolean

CheckEmptyBin

procedure CheckEmptyBin(LocationCode: Code[10], BinCode: Code[20], CaptionOfField: Text[30])

Parameters

Name Type Description
LocationCode Code[10]
BinCode Code[20]
CaptionOfField Text[30]

GetRequirementText

procedure GetRequirementText(FieldNumber: Integer): Text[50]

Parameters

Name Type Description
FieldNumber Integer

Returns

Type Description
Text[50]

DisplayMap

procedure DisplayMap()

IsBWReceive

procedure IsBWReceive(): Boolean

Returns

Type Description
Boolean

IsBWShip

procedure IsBWShip(): Boolean

Returns

Type Description
Boolean

IsBinBWReceiveOrShip

procedure IsBinBWReceiveOrShip(BinCode: Code[20]): Boolean

Parameters

Name Type Description
BinCode Code[20]

Returns

Type Description
Boolean

IsInTransit

procedure IsInTransit(LocationCode: Code[10]): Boolean

Parameters

Name Type Description
LocationCode Code[10]

Returns

Type Description
Boolean

GetLocationsIncludingUnspecifiedLocation

procedure GetLocationsIncludingUnspecifiedLocation(IncludeOnlyUnspecifiedLocation: Boolean, ExcludeInTransitLocations: Boolean)

Parameters

Name Type Description
IncludeOnlyUnspecifiedLocation Boolean
ExcludeInTransitLocations Boolean

PickAccordingToFEFO

procedure PickAccordingToFEFO(): Boolean

Returns

Type Description
Boolean

SelectMultipleLocations

procedure SelectMultipleLocations(): Text

Returns

Type Description
Text

See also